2020 First Issue #64 - Documentary Photography
In this month's Issue #64 dedicated to Documentary Photography, We have the privilege to feature quality and most prestigious series by professional international photographers, including an exclusive interview with José jeuland, featuring his latest project: Haenyeo, women divers of the sea.
Anne-Marie Weber exhibits her sensitive long term project: The controversial subject of gun ownership in the USA, Taysir Batniji, one of the most influential Palestinian documentary and fine art Photographer features Two special Projects: WATCHTOWERS | FATHERS. This issue exhibits extraordinary photographers, including Rajesh K. Singh, William Castellana, Stephen Uhraney, Gary Mulcahey, Debasish Ghosh, and Aga Szydlik; all are giving a direct and a courageous look at the reality around us.
More you will find exhibitions coverage at the Brooklyn Museum and Bruce Silverstein Gallery.
